Handover note — Pelican address autocomplete widget. Hey, welcome aboard! Quick rundown: the widget lives in the Storefront repo under /widgets/addrpick. It debounces keystrokes at 250ms and caches suggestions per session — don't touch that without benchmarking, we learned the hard way. Known quirk: apartment numbers sometimes get dropped when the Quillmark geocoder times out; there's a retry wrapper half-finished on my branch. Docs are in the team wiki under "Addrpick". Any questions about the backlog should go to the new owner.

named custodian: Oliath Ralax

## Component Library Versioning

The Saltmere shared component library follows strict semver, and the on-call engineer should verify that any hotfix release only bumps the patch version. Consuming apps pin to minor ranges, so an accidental minor bump during an incident can fan out breakage overnight. After tagging, publish through the Lanthorn pipeline, which signs each package; the signing key is recorded below.

release key, fajef-kajeg: bky19_LdLu6Ne6FLi8he2c24d

Ticket HL-2241: Catalogue import for the Bramwell Library consortium. The MARC-to-Lantern converter is complete and has been validated against a 50k-record sample; duplicate detection runs on normalized title plus publication year. Before the full 2.1M-record import can run in production, we need a formal sign-off confirming the deduplication thresholds and the rollback snapshot plan. Please review the attached validation report. The sign-off must come from:

signatory, kahop-kafof: Druath Quenax

- [ ] **Step 7: Breaker override escrow.** After sealing the signing keys for the Tallgrove upstream API circuit breaker, confirm the support team can force the breaker open during a full outage. The override bundle lives in the sealed escrow drawer and is useless without its unlock phrase. Two ceremony witnesses must initial this step before proceeding. The escrow bundle is decrypted with the recovery passphrase that follows.

vault phrase of kahip-kahop = holath-quenmir